impertinent中文什么意思
adj.
1.无礼的,鲁莽的,傲慢的。
2.不适当的,不恰当的。
3.离题的,不得要领的。

英文释义
形容词- improperly forward or bold; "don''t be fresh with me"; "impertinent of a child to lecture a grownup"; "an impudent boy given to insulting strangers"; "Don''t get wise with me!"
同义词:fresh, impudent, overbold, smart, saucy, sassy, wise - not pertinent to the matter under consideration; "an issue extraneous to the debate"; "the price was immaterial"; "mentioned several impertinent facts before finally coming to the point"
同义词:extraneous, immaterial, orthogonal - characterized by a lightly pert and exuberant quality; "a certain irreverent gaiety and ease of manner"
同义词:irreverent, pert, saucy
